MINUTES OF THE LAKE ELMO CITY COUNCIL MEETING JULY 1, 1975 pg< 1 <br />Meeting called to order at 7:30 PM by Mayor Eder. <br />Present: Mayor Eder, Councilmen Abercrombie, Shervheim, Pott & Councilwoman Lyons. <br />Also present: Bldg. Insp. Mueller, Counsel Raleigh, Engineer Bonestroo,`Planner Licht <br />and PZC Chairman Johnson. <br />Minutes: Motion by Councilman Shervheim 2nd by Councilman Pott to approve the <br />minutes of the June 17, 1975 meeting as submitted. Carried 4-0 <br />Councilwoman Lyons tardy. <br />Advance Refunding:Steve Mattson, Juran &.Moody, advised that no bids were received <br />for the June 17, 1975 offering. Mr. Mattson requested permission to try <br />again August 5, 1975. <br />Councilman Abercrombie offered Resolution R75-20 authorizing rebid on <br />the $739,000 Park Bond Advance Refunding and asked council approval. <br />Second by Councilman Shervheim. Carried 4-0. Mayor Eder abstained. <br />Pearl Kuehn Peterson:Motion by Councilman Shervheim 2nd by Councilman Abercrombie to <br />approve minor subdivision on Lot A Bordner Garner Farmettes subject to <br />conditions recommended by the PZC at their meeting June 23, 1975. <br />Carried 5-0. The $200 deposit to guarantee completion of the survey <br />has been received in the clerk's office. <br />John -Caputo: Was interested in Outlot B (5 acres) in Derrick's proposed plat. He <br />was considering purchase with the hope of building in August this year. <br />Mr. Caputo was advised that the land was potentially park land and he <br />would, in all probability, not be able to get a permit to build. <br />Planning: Councilman Shervheim, Planner Licht and PZC Chairman Johnson presented <br />detail on their meeting of June 10, 1975. Written summary dated June <br />13, 1975 on file. <br />Motion by Councilman Abercrombie 2.nd by Councilman Shervheim to auth- <br />orize counsel, planner and PZC chairman to prepare a proposed procedure, <br />including flow chart to be used in processing development plans.Carried 5-0. <br />Claims: Motion by Councilman Pott 2nd by Councilman Abercrombie to approve the <br />payment of claims 75340 thru 75382. Carried 5-0. <br />Legion St: Residents on Legion St. appeared and voiced concern over the amount of <br />water in the area East of Legion and South of 30th St. They asked what <br />could be done to releive situation. They were advised that this was <br />part of the overall water problem and it would be considered. <br />Waste Disposition:Mr. Gary Thompson, Thompson Roll -Off Systems, appeared at the re- <br />quest of the .council. He suggested possibility of setting up a permanent <br />box location. He would supply a 20, 30 or 40 yard box which he would re- <br />move on 24 hour notice and replace with an empty box. If pulled twice a <br />month the cost would be $56 for a 20 yard box, $66 for a 30 yard box <br />and $76 for a 40 yard box. Larger boxes are more difficult to load and <br />you don't get a full load in the box. Mr. Thompson advised that he had <br />a 4 yard compactor for sale. He could probably set us up for about <br />$10,000. New unit would be $12-15,000. Council will consider. <br />
